Build a system that makes you a world-class leader.
One Workspace, the meta-prompting pack, and Claude Code — stand up your own executive assistant, expert, and board of advisors, documented in folders you can rerun any time.
Five steps
Create your Workspace.
Make a new folder on your Desktop called Workspace. This is home base: everything Claude Code builds for you lives here, so you can open it any time and pick up right where you left off.
Why one folder?
Claude Code works inside a single directory. Keep one Workspace and your skills, commands, and docs stay together — a system you reopen next week, not a chat you have to recreate.
Add the meta-prompting pack.
Download the meta-prompting pack and drop its files into a folder called Workspace/.claude. This pack is what gives Claude the skills and commands you're about to use.
Mind the dot
.claude (with the leading period) is hidden on purpose. Without it, Claude Code won't find the pack — with it, every skill and slash command inside it shows up automatically, including /create-prompt.
Review your Claude connections.
Open your Claude connections and add any that are missing — calendar, email, drive, your task tracker. Each one is another thing your assistant can actually do on your behalf, not just talk about.
Why it matters
A board of advisors that can't see your calendar or inbox is guessing. Wire up your real tools so Claude works from what's actually on your plate.
Open Claude Code on your Workspace.
In the Claude desktop app, start a new Claude Code session and select your Workspace folder. Now Claude has your skills, your commands, and your connections in one place — pointed straight at the folder where your system will live.
New session, one folder
Selecting Workspace tells Claude Code where to read the pack and where to write everything it builds. From here, the whole system takes shape inside that one folder.
Run /create-prompt to build your system.
Kick the whole thing off with one meta-prompt. Claude designs the folders, skills, and commands for you — a system you can reopen and rerun any week.
Run this
/create-prompt how might we create a markdown-based system and set of skills/commands where I can regularly run Claude Code to help me be the best world-class $ROLE possible. I'm planning to use you as my personal executive assistant, $ROLE expert and board of advisors. Document everything in a series of folders as you see fit.Make it yours
Swap $ROLE for what you actually do — CTO, VP of Engineering, founder, product lead. Claude documents everything in folders, so next week you just open your Workspace and run it again.
